Transaction 86ff25804674ab5a28d651b46ab8bab4265c2eb970b8e0bee12b8ce8be661298
1 Input
1 Output
-
86ff25804674ab5a28d651b46ab8bab4265c2eb970b8e0bee12b8ce8be661298:0
- value
- 16667570
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1b8ba79e28bd7c6816d8a8c65e7e1aeed3e64cd8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13WeYZbkVcgTztqmiCdrY2KpPkTcNiGAzU